How do I choose the right material for a driveway, patio, or landscaping project in Logan County?

Start by matching the material to the job: consider load (cars vs foot traffic), drainage needs, desired look, and long-term maintenance. In Logan County, think about local drainage and how much traffic the surface will see; materials like gravel, sand, dirt, stone each perform differently for load, drainage, and weed control. When is the best time of year in Logan County to order and install outdoor materials?

Timing depends on the project and local weather: avoid very wet or frozen ground because delivery and compaction are harder, and windy seasons can make spreading dusty materials more difficult. Late spring through early fall is usually best for installation, but deliveries can be scheduled year-round; select a delivery date at checkout and consider next-day options if you need material quickly (orders before noon CST).

What local conditions in Logan County should influence my material choice and preparation?

Local factors like drainage, slope, freeze-thaw cycles, and wind exposure affect material performance and longevity. Because materials are regionally sourced, texture and color may vary, and site prep such as grading, geotextile fabric, or a compacted base may be recommended to prevent settling and erosion. Which projects in Logan County commonly use bulk materials, and how does that affect material choice?

Common projects include driveways and resurfacing, patios and pathways, erosion control and berms, garden beds and topsoil placement, and base or fill work for outbuildings. For driveways you’ll prioritize load-bearing and drainage; for landscaping and garden beds you may prioritize soil quality and finish appearance; for erosion control you’ll focus on stability and weight. Choosing the right material group (gravel, sand, dirt, stone) depends on these project goals and the site conditions.

How do suppliers and contractors estimate how much material I need for a Logan County project?

Most estimates start with the area (length x width) and a target depth, converted to cubic yards and then to tons using a conversion factor. Typical guidance: 2-3 inches for top dressing paths, 3-6 inches for residential driveways, and deeper bases for heavy traffic; use our online material calculator or share your dimensions for a quick estimate. Contractors may add 5-10% for waste and compaction, depending on site conditions.

What should I expect for delivery in rural Logan County addresses?

Deliveries are made by contracted dump trucks (typically tri-axle) and require accessible driveways or a safe drop zone; Hello Gravel has a minimum order of 3 tons. Rural deliveries may have additional charges for long distances, off-road drops, or tight access, and drivers will confirm logistics before arrival. Do I need permits or special permissions for large material deliveries or driveway projects in Logan County?

Permit requirements vary by project type and location; some driveway cuts, commercial work, or large-scale grading may require county or township permits or right-of-way approval. Check with Logan County government or your township before starting work, especially for curb cuts, driveway permits, or public-road access restrictions. What are typical cost components for a bulk material order and how can I get a reliable price for a Logan County job?

Total cost typically includes the material price per ton, delivery fee (distance and access can affect this), and any optional services like spreading or staging. Prices vary by material type and local availability; instead of a general dollar amount, request a quote through our site with your zip code and project details for a transparent price.
